About Leaders on Fire Podcast

Welcome to the Leaders on Fire podcast, where we dive  into the defining crucible moments that shape resilient leaders. Each episode features inspiring guests who share their personal journeys of challenge, perseverance, and growth. Powered by C4One, this podcast is for those seeking to ignite their leadership through faith and community. Join us as we explore how God refines character in the fire and transforms lives. The Prioritized Leader: Profit

Profit isn’t the villain; misplaced priorities are. We wrap the Prioritized Leader journey by showing how purpose, people, pace, and perception create the conditions for healthy profit—and why what you do with margin determines your true impact. You’ll hear a vulnerable story about profit anxiety quietly steering decisions, the relief that comes from realignment, and the freedom of shifting from ownership to stewardship. We dig into a practical and deeply motivating idea: God is the owner, and we are stewards. That mindset doesn’t weaken performance; it elevates it. When every dollar is treated as mission fuel, excellence becomes a trust, teams find fresh meaning in their work, and generosity stops being an afterthought. We share how Leaders on Fire models “purposeful profit” by committing 100% of profits to reinvestment and giving, and how that conviction turned into tangible change—like long-term support for Christ-centered education in the Dominican Republic. Vision trips connect frontline work to lives transformed, revealing the flywheel: purpose inspires, people engage, pace protects, perception clarifies, and profit multiplies impact. If you’re ready to reorder your leadership from the inside out, we also walk through concrete next steps. The Prioritized Leader course and assessment surface where you’re thriving or stuck across the five priorities, then guide you with lectures and workbooks to embed the right order into daily habits. Roundtables and coaching offer accountability and a space to grow, whether you’re early in your faith or seasoned in leadership. Leave with a clear takeaway: margin serves mission, and stewardship turns profit into purpose. The Prioritized Leader: Perception

Clarity isn’t luck; it’s built. We take a hard look at perception as the quiet force behind great leadership—how you see yourself, your people, your pace, and your future—and why leaders who slow down actually move farther, faster. Through honest stories and practical frameworks, we unpack four pillars that sharpen the lens: clarity of vision, discernment, self-awareness, and reality checks. Miss one and your plans wobble; integrate all four and decisions get cleaner, conversations get kinder, and culture gets stronger. You’ll hear why morning quiet time and journaling create outsized returns on focus, how a simple jar-of-water metaphor can reset a frantic mind, and why healthy pace is the foundation for seeing clearly. We talk about faith as a source of discernment, the battle with pride that clouds judgment, and the small, repeatable habits that keep perception crisp: dedicated thinking blocks, trusted feedback circles, and lightweight tools that reveal how others experience your leadership. We also connect perception to innovation—reading weak signals in your market, aligning team capacity to shifting needs, and avoiding the trap of plans built on expired assumptions. If you want your intentions to land, start by sharpening how you see. Listen for ways to pair purpose with people, calibrate pace, and then let perception turn insight into action. When leaders slow the jar and let the sediment settle, vision clears, peace returns, and the next step becomes obvious. The Prioritized Leader: Pace

Ever feel like you’re sprinting a marathon and still slipping behind? We dig into the hidden mechanics of pace and show how it sits at the center of purpose, people, perception, and profit. Using Iron Man racing as a vivid lens, we unpack why fueling, recovery, and cadence decisions determine whether your team finishes strong or flames out. If you’ve ever watched a high performer go “zombie mode” near a deadline, you’ll recognize the cost of poor pacing—and the relief that comes with doing it right. We start by redefining fueling for business: the investments you make in your people, yourself, and the company’s systems. Think practical training, clear processes, and psychological safety instead of empty perks. From there, we map endurance rhythms you can implement this week: no-meeting blocks for deep work, planned sprints with real cool-downs, and leader-modeled boundaries that protect energy. You’ll hear how a people-first culture can push to a 10 when crisis hits, then glide back to baseline without resentment or burnout. We also connect pace to perception—the leader’s ability to see around corners, plan with clarity, and innovate under pressure. When speed stays redlined, cortisol narrows your field of view and you miss the moments that matter. Adaptive pace restores perspective. We share a simple framework that blends fueling strategies, recovery rituals, adaptability in changing seasons, and the kind of grit that sustains excellence without glorifying exhaustion. If you want a team that moves fast and finishes well, this is your playbook. The Prioritized Leader: People

Culture doesn’t change because of a poster on the wall; it changes when leaders make people their next priority after purpose. We dig into what that looks like day to day and why simple, repeatable behaviors—listening well, recognizing effort, and showing up alongside your team—move engagement and performance faster than any new process. You’ll hear a real turnaround story from an acquired branch that went from worst to best on engagement and results by putting a character-driven, shepherd-style leader in place who balanced care with accountability. We unpack the invitation–challenge matrix to show how belonging and high standards can coexist without burning people out. If you’ve ever wondered why some teams feel safe and driven while others feel anxious or complacent, this framework gives you language and levers you can use immediately. We also break down the Five C’s—character, competency, capacity, chemistry, and calling—as a practical lens for hiring, coaching, and self-evaluation. Expect real tactics: how to recognize people in ways that land, how to read the room with emotional intelligence, and how to avoid spending all your time on chronic low performers while neglecting steady contributors. Finally, we connect people-first leadership to sustainable pace. When trust is banked, teams can sprint for a season and recover without cracking. That’s how purpose flows into profit through people. If you’re ready to build a culture where belonging fuels excellence and accountability feels like care, this conversation delivers the tools and mindset to start today. The Prioritized Leader: Purpose

Fire needs fuel—our leadership needs purpose. We dive straight into the why behind the work, tracing the moments that shaped our convictions and the practices that keep them alive. From a powerful birth story that reset identity to three years serving in the jungles of Papua New Guinea, we unpack how a clear purpose turns fear into focus and even gives meaning to hardship. The thread runs from the deeply personal to the highly practical: how purpose informs vision, how values guide daily choices, and how alignment between personal calling and company mission can transform culture, hiring, generosity, and impact. We share the backbone of our framework—the five priorities—and explain why purpose sits at the top. You’ll hear how a family business grew by placing mission at the center, tithing as a company, and stewarding resources to empower others to flourish. We make the case that purpose is more than a statement on a wall; it’s a decision filter that shapes what you start, what you stop, and what you stay with when the road gets long. When vision (where you’re going) and values (how you act) integrate with purpose (why it matters), leaders gain clarity that scales. If you’ve felt adrift or unsure how to turn a vague calling into concrete action, we walk through tools that help: the Prioritized Leader Purpose module with video guidance and a workbook to define personal purpose, organizational purpose, and lived values; plus our Epic Story: All In resources that root identity and calling in a redemptive narrative. Whether you’re building a startup, leading a team, or rethinking your career, this conversation offers a path to align your why with your work and live it out with courage and consistency.
